Green revolution was the advanvement in agriculture and production of crops and higher yields because of the introduction of new machines, use of effective fertilisers and other chemicals, introduction of high-yielding varieties, etc.

It helped the cricis of food in India in the following ways :

♦ High-yielding varieties of crops were used to increase production of crops.

♦ Use of effective fertilisers and other chemicals to reduce agricultural loses.

♦ Use of latest agriculturals implements and machines to save time and labour.

♦ Early maturing variety of crops were used so that farmers can grow more crops in one land at a perticular season.

♦ Use of disease and pest resistant variety of crops to increase production of crops.
